According to Air Peace’s Chief Operating Officer, Toyin Olajide, all economy class tickets on the airline’s flights from Lagos to London are reserved for the next sixty days, beginning in July.

Travel agencies and Nigerian passengers on the Lagos-London route have commended Air Peace for starting flights to European locations three months ago.

Olajide acknowledged the many difficulties the airline had encountered on the route in a recent interview in Lagos, but he was pleased that the carrier was now providing Nigerians with an alternative.

 Air Peace’s Lagos to London Flights Fully Booked for 60 Days

Olajide claims that every economy seat on the airline’s Sunday, June 30, 2024 flight was taken, and every one of the 41 business class seats was also taken. She mentioned that there had been a problem with advertising first-class seats, which has since been resolved by the management.

Furthermore, Olajide clarified that Nigerians who are travelling to the UK from the US frequently reserve Air Peace to Lagos in order to take advantage of cheap flights from the US to Europe.

When compared to direct flights from the US to Nigeria, this results in significant cost savings for passengers on the US-UK-Nigeria itineraries.

She also added that, in order to save money on their travels, Chinese nationals residing in Nigeria usually take Air Peace to London before connecting with China Southern Airlines to China.

 

She said: “But our system did not advertise our first-class seats, an error that has been corrected. So, what it means is that we recorded a very high load factor, only 12 seats in the first class and one business class seat; that is, 13 seats were empty out of the 274-seat capacity aircraft. We thank Nigerians. We appreciate the fact that they are happy with the airline.

“We recently upgraded two passengers who flew from the US to London and used our flight to Lagos. We upgraded them from economy class to business class in appreciation of their commitment and desire to patronise us. But they also take advantage of the cheap flights between Europe and the US, and our flights are also affordable. So, this enables them to save a lot of money.

“The entrance of Air Peace into this market has not only increased accessibility but also diversified the passenger base. Remarkably, the airline has attracted elderly passengers who previously could not afford high ticket prices post-pandemic, as well as students returning home for family events and reunions. This influx has resulted in a 5 per cent to 15 per cent increase in passengers.”

Olajide claims that Air Peace’s operations have been instrumental in enhancing the favourable brand positioning of Nigerian companies.

Products such native long-grain Nigerian rice, Gratia chin chin flakes, Olu Olu chips, and farm-fresh yoghurt had become more well-known and had a wider market reach.

“This ripple effect has benefited small businesses and local farmers who supply produce like tomatoes, peppers, and spinach, contributing to an economic expansion of over N2bn,” she added.

The Federal Government has initiated the process to allow Nigerian airlines to have direct access to international routes to the United States and South American countries, according to a recent announcement made by Minister of Aviation and Aerospace Development Festus Keyamo.

Air Peace began offering flights from Lagos to London on March 20.
